Jquery $.getJSON 在IE下的緩存問題解決方法
在工作中主頁實(shí)現(xiàn)Ztree Ztree的數(shù)據(jù)是后臺(tái)返回的JSON對(duì)象
因?yàn)闃涫枪潭ǖ乃悦看嗡⑿聵?/p>
$.getJSON 的url都是相同的 問題來了 我修改 或者 新增樹節(jié)點(diǎn) 然后刷新tree IE竟然毫無變化 在其他瀏覽器上面都OK
這讓我糾結(jié)了
然后在網(wǎng)上搜索了一下資料發(fā)現(xiàn) 解決辦法
解決辦法:
Jquery 的 $.getJSON請(qǐng)求有一個(gè)緩存機(jī)制 就是在請(qǐng)求相同URL訪問后臺(tái)時(shí)候 他會(huì)直接從頁面緩存的數(shù)據(jù)中取出來數(shù)據(jù) 而不是請(qǐng)求后臺(tái)
所以我們要改變一個(gè)URL
這是我們的URL var url =“XXXX/XXX”
下面來一個(gè) 生成隨機(jī)數(shù)的方法
function GetRandomNum(Min,Max)
{
var Range = Max - Min;
var Rand = Math.random();
return(Min + Math.round(Rand * Range));
}
然后改變我們的URL
var i=GetRandomNum(1,100);
url=url+“&random=”+i;
然后把URl穿進(jìn)去就可以了 問題解決
- jQuery+ajax中g(shù)etJSON() 用法實(shí)例
- jQuery中$.get、$.post、$.getJSON和$.ajax的用法詳解
- Jquery getJSON方法詳細(xì)分析
- Jquery中$.get(),$.post(),$.ajax(),$.getJSON()的用法總結(jié)
- jquery的$getjson調(diào)用并獲取遠(yuǎn)程的JSON字符串問題
- jquery $.getJSON()跨域請(qǐng)求
- jQuery.get、jQuery.getJSON、jQuery.post無法返回JSON問題的解決方法
- JQuery中的$.getJSON 使用說明
- jQuery與getJson結(jié)合的用法實(shí)例
相關(guān)文章
jQuery+css實(shí)現(xiàn)的點(diǎn)擊圖片放大縮小預(yù)覽功能示例【圖片預(yù)覽 查看大圖】
這篇文章主要介紹了jQuery+css實(shí)現(xiàn)的點(diǎn)擊圖片放大縮小預(yù)覽功能,結(jié)合實(shí)例形式分析了jQuery+css控制圖片放大、縮小預(yù)覽查看的相關(guān)操作技巧,需要的朋友可以參考下2020-05-05jQuery插件EnPlaceholder實(shí)現(xiàn)輸入框提示文字
EnPlaceholder插件支持密碼框哦!實(shí)際對(duì)比同類的placeholder插件在ie等瀏覽器下效果要好很多!下面我們來具體探討下此插件的使用方法吧。2015-06-06jQuery Password Validation密碼驗(yàn)證
這篇文章主要介紹了jQuery Password Validation密碼驗(yàn)證的相關(guān)資料,具有一定的參考價(jià)值,感興趣的小伙伴們可以參考一下2016-12-12jquery 字符串切割函數(shù)substring的用法說明
本篇文章主要是對(duì)jquery字符串切割函數(shù)substring的用法進(jìn)行了介紹,需要的朋友可以過來參考下,希望對(duì)大家有所幫助2014-02-02jQuery操作attr、prop、val()/text()/html()、class屬性
這篇文章主要介紹了jQuery操作attr、prop、val()/text()/html()、class屬性 ,本文通過實(shí)例代碼給大家介紹的非常詳細(xì),具有一定的參考借鑒價(jià)值,需要的朋友可以參考下2019-05-05jQuery插件開發(fā)基礎(chǔ)簡(jiǎn)單介紹
jquery插件開發(fā)基礎(chǔ):開發(fā)jQuery 插件的基本格式,開發(fā)全局函數(shù)的基本格式,接下來為您詳細(xì)介紹,感興趣的朋友可以了解哦2013-01-01jQuery滑動(dòng)到底部加載下一頁數(shù)據(jù)的實(shí)例代碼
這篇文章主要介紹了jQuery滑動(dòng)到底部加載下一頁數(shù)據(jù)的實(shí)例代碼,需要的朋友可以參考下2017-05-05